https://www.hemmings.com/auction/1968-dodge-charger-jensen-beach-fl-227127

This 1968 Dodge Charger Convertible will elicit double takes from onlookers and spark conversation wherever it goes, since the automaker never produced this model in a droptop. According to its seller, “It’s a real-deal Charger, not a converted Coronet.” The shipping order number on the fender tag matches number on the radiator core support. According to the documentation provided, the car was restored and modified in 2008-’09.

He goes on to say, “I bought it in 2020 already completed. It’s a turnkey car with a big-block engine, automatic transmission, and a power top. It has been garaged and needs nothing. You’ll have difficulty finding another one, no less another for sale.”
